The Rev. John H. Clelland; Retired Pastor

Share

The Rev. John H. Clelland, pastor of El Bethel Apostolic Church of Pacoima for more than 30 years, has died at a Sun Valley hospital. He was 84.

Clelland died Tuesday of a heart attack, said his wife, Esther Clelland.

Clelland was born in Louisville, Ky., and was pastor of a Pentecostal church in Bloomington, Ind., before coming to California in 1955.

In Los Angeles, he served as assistant pastor to the local bishop of the Indianapolis-based Pentecostal Assemblies of the World. In 1957, Clelland started El Bethel Apostolic Church from a small prayer meeting in the San Fernando Valley. Clelland served as pastor of the church until his retirement in November. He also had served as district elder of the Pentecostal Assemblies of the World.

In addition to his wife of 36 years, Clelland is survived by his daughter, Elizabeth Beard of Los Angeles; 14 grandchildren, and 16 great-grandchildren. A son, John Martin Clelland, died in 1985, and a daughter, Clara Jean Boyd, died in 1971.
